This free one-hour event, presented by the Minnesota Library Data Group, will take place at 1:00 p.m. on February 11. Registration is via Zoom.

This is the first webinar in support of the group's new data discussion list, which aims to create conversation and community around library data in Minnesota.

Jill Holman will discuss the MnPALS consortium's short course on data storytelling, and outline key concepts. Participants will then go through an exercise to get them thinking about the data they have, in order to start sketching out their own data stories.
